With respect to music, it is well known music worldwide is typically composed and performed using a subset of 12 specific frequency intervals (called chromatic scale tones) from any octave within the middle range of human hearing. In an effort to understand the biological basis for these otherwise puzzling tonal preferences in music, we showed that most of the 12 chromatic scale intervals correspond to peaks of relative power in the normalized spectrum of human vocalizations (Schwartz et al., 2003; see also Schwartz and Purves, 2004).

The National Academy of Sciences has released an important new report detailing how geomagnetic storms could damage the infrastructure of modern society. An area of particular vulnerability is power grids. Ground currents induced during century-class storms can melt the huge, multi-ton transformers at the heart of power distribution systems. Because modern power grids are interconnected, a cascade of failures could sweep across the country, rapidly cutting power to tens or even hundreds of millions of people:
